Savers is a large UK retailer of health and beauty products
Savers Health & Beauty is a leading UK retailer, offering a wide range of health, household, and beauty products at competitive prices. With over 500 physical stores across the UK and an online shop, Savers has built a strong reputation for providing top-quality products and famous brands at low prices.
The company was founded in 1988 and has since expanded to over 520 stores in England, Northern Ireland, Scotland, and Wales. Savers is known for its excellent customer service, with friendly and knowledgeable staff assisting customers in finding what they need. The product range includes skincare, cosmetics, health, and household essentials, as well as fragrances.
In terms of perfumes, Savers offers a variety of options at significantly lower prices than competitors. For example, the DKNY Be Delicious 50ml perfume is priced at £19.99 in Savers, compared to £48.99 at Superdrug. Other perfume brands available at Savers include Marc Jacobs, Gucci, Britney Spears, and Jimmy Choo, among others.
While some customers have expressed concern about the authenticity of perfumes purchased from Savers, there is no definitive evidence to suggest that they are not genuine. It is important to note that Savers is a legitimate retailer and part of the A.S. Watson Group, which also owns Superdrug and The Perfume Shop. Therefore, it is likely that the perfumes sold at Savers are authentic, and the low prices can be attributed to the company's focus on value retailing.

Savers' perfumes can be authenticated by their packaging
Savers is a well-known name in the beauty and health industry, and it has won numerous awards for providing customers with the best products at reasonable prices. The company has a strong foundation, being owned by the A.S. Watson Group, which also owns other large distribution centres in the UK, such as Superdrug and The Perfume Shop.
When it comes to authenticating Savers perfumes, one of the most important factors to consider is the packaging. The wrapping of a perfume can often indicate its authenticity at first glance. Perfumes from authentic brands are typically packaged in high-quality paperboards to increase the value and protect the bottle from damage. On the other hand, fake perfumes are often sold in loose paperboards or even open bottles.
Another crucial aspect to look for is the serial number. A genuine perfume will have the serial number inscribed at the bottom of the box, rather than glued on. By examining these factors, you can be more confident in the authenticity of your Savers perfume purchase.
